A Graduate Certificate in Mental Health Awareness Initiatives equ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to promote mental well-being within their organizations and communities. This specialized program focuses on practical application and impactful strategies.
Learning outcomes typically include a deep understanding of mental health conditions, effective communication techniques for sensitive conversations, and the ability to design and implement mental health awareness programs. Students learn to identify risk factors, promote help-seeking behaviors, and foster a supportive environment.
The program duration is usually concise, often completed within a year or less, allowing professionals to upskill quickly and efficiently. This accelerated format is designed to minimize disruption to existing work commitments while maximizing learning impact.

A Graduate Certificate in Mental Health Awareness is increasingly significant in today's UK market. The rising prevalence of mental health issues necessitates a workforce equipped to understand and support colleagues and clients. According to the Mental Health Foundation, 1 in 4 people in the UK experience a mental health problem each year. This translates to millions needing support, highlighting the urgent demand for mental health literacy.
